Global HVAC Market: Snapshot

HVAC is short for heating, ventilation and air conditioning and players in the global HVAC market are involved in the development, innovation, manufacture and sale of these systems and devices. HVAC in computing is the control of the environment in which a company or data center operates. This includes changing the ambient temperature, humidity, and other factors to improve the venue’s optimal performance. HVAC management can require a high level of planning and operation for larger structures, particularly those that include data centers, power systems, security and safety equipment, complex wiring, and computer hardware. This also means that the planning and implementation of the HVAC management can take place in parallel with the construction of a project and therefore a separate HVAC contractor must be engaged.

Every single physical electronic device today can operate within certain temperature, pressure, humidity, and humidity ranges, and exceeding these limits can severely affect the operating capacity or the quality of the hardware. These ranges are usually specified on the device itself, which is data that can be used in HVAC planning. The devices themselves are also prone to giving off large amounts of heat during peak hours and therefore need external help to control their temperature. An example of HVAC planning in a building could be the construction of a plenary, part of a building that only houses the HVAC airflow systems and wiring.

Global HVAC Motors Market: Overview

Heating, ventilation and air conditioning (HVAC) is the technology that helps control temperature, humidity and air quality in interiors and vehicles. HVAC systems are used in office and industrial buildings to efficiently manage cooling and heating costs, especially when the assembly is large and requires different temperature zones throughout the building.

The global HVAC market can be segmented according to various parameters. By type, it can be divided into condenser fan motors, cooler / cooling tower motors, fan and blower motors, and shaft grounding motors, for example. Depending on the application, it can be divided into air conditioner, air handling unit, unit, heat pump, furnace, WSHP, fan and fan-operated terminal unit.

Global HVAC market: drivers and trends

At the forefront of the growth in the global HVAC market is favorable political support such as government incentives through tax credit programs and various energy saving rules. Other market-driving factors are the flourishing construction and infrastructure activities as well as the increasing shift towards smart homes. In fact, commercial buildings pioneered the adoption of heating, ventilation and air conditioning (HVAC) technologies. This has resulted in higher production of HVAC motors in the region. In the coming years, the residential real estate market will dwarf the non-residential real estate market in terms of demand.

In the coming years, the growth of the global HVAC market will be driven by the intelligent technology that will lead to the adoption of the most advanced monitoring systems. Monitoring systems help monitor a building’s energy usage, while smart technology helps control the energy output of an HVAC system. For example, fans, which are used in the heating of computer systems, are only switched on after a certain temperature has been reached in the computer system, which makes it energy efficient. The combination of the Internet of Things (IoT) and heating, ventilation and air conditioning systems (HVAC) also creates opportunities in the market. The commercial construction sector is likely to adopt this technology as this integration would increase the efficiency and reliability of the building automation and control system (BAS).
